首页 > 编程语言 >3.java-环境搭建

3.java-环境搭建

时间:2024-07-18 16:55:55浏览次数:7  
标签:JRE java JDK -- 环境 path 环境变量 搭建

三 java语言的环境搭建

1.了解JRE JDK

	JRE(java runtime environment java运行环境)
		包括java虚拟机(JVM)和java程序所需的核心类库等,如果想要一个开发好的java程序,计算机中只需要安装JRE即可。
	JDK(java development kit java开发工具包)
		jdk是提供给java开发人员使用的,其中包含了java的开发工具,也包括了JRE,所以安装JDK,就不用在单独安装JRE了。
		其中的开发工具:编译工具(java.exe) 打包工具(jar.exe)等
	简单而言:使用JDK 开发完成的java程序,交给JRE去运行。	

2.下载JDK(java开发工具包)

	www.oracle.com
	java.sun.com 

3.winds dos命令行指令查找先后顺序

		dos命令的执行的命令,系统首先会去找当前目录下是否存在,假如不存在,就会去找系统的path的环境变量

4.配置环境变量 为了更方便的运用java开发工具

	配置永久环境变量
		 winds  右击我的电脑 --> 点击属性 --> 点击【更改设置】 --> 点击【高级】 --> 点击【环境变量】 --> 下半部分的【系统变量】中找到path --> 【编辑】 --> 将需要配置的变量的路径填写(到该程序所在的目录即可)进去保存即可。
		配置技巧:将路径设置为自己的环境变量
			添加系统变量  
				变量名:jdk13.0
				变量值:E:\MEG\Java\jdk-13.0.2
			添加path变量:使用%jdk%获取上面jdk的动态值
				%jdk13.0%\bin
				
	配置临时环境变量
		set path=E:\MEG\Java\jdk-13.0.2\bin;%path%
			set命令配置临时环境变量:%path%	将原有的环境变量也添加进去。

标签:JRE,java,JDK,--,环境,path,环境变量,搭建
From: https://www.cnblogs.com/megshuai/p/18309938

相关文章

  • java-算数运算符
    6.6.1算数运算符运算符运算范例结果+正号+300300-负号b=4;-b-4|+ | 加 | 5+5 | 10 || - | 减 | 7-4 | 3|||||||* | 乘 | 3*4 | 12|| / | 除 | 5/5 | 1|||||||% | 取模(取余数) | 5%5 | 0|||||| ++ | 自增(前)| a=2;b=++a| a=3;......
  • 2.java-注释
    6.1java的三种注释方式,方便用来调试程序。注意:多行注释中不可以再有多行注释。 单行注释中可以有再有单行注释。 多行注释中可以再有单行注释注释添加的位置 类上面添加文档注释 主函数上面添加多行注释 代码当中几乎话难懂会加单行注释进行说明 //注......
  • 4.java-常量与变量
    6.3常量与变量常量 概念:表示不能变化的数值 java中常量的分类 1.整数常量,所有整数 2.小数常量,所有小数 3.布尔特常量。较为特有,只有两个数值,true、false 4.字符常量,将一个数字字母或者符号用单引号('')标识。 5.字符串常量,将一个或者多个字符用双引号("")标识。 6.n......
  • Vim 高手指南:Linux 环境下的高级使用技巧
    Vim高手指南:Linux环境下的高级使用技巧前言Vim是一个功能强大的文本编辑器,广泛应用于Linux系统以及各种编程环境中。作为一个Vim高级用户和Linux系统管理员,你将在这里学到如何充分利用Vim的高级功能,提升你的工作效率。第1章:Vim编辑器的基本概念和模式1.1Vi......
  • C++中的vector对应Java中的什么类型?
    C++中的vector对应Java中的ArrayList类型。‌C++中的vector和Java中的ArrayList都是可变长的数组或数组列表,‌它们具有以下相似特性:‌两者都是动态数组,‌可以根据需要自动增长。‌它们都支持通过索引访问元素,‌并且元素是有序的。‌它们都提供了添加、‌删除和查询元素的方法......
  • 使用Java实现高性能的消息队列系统在淘客返利系统中的应用
    使用Java实现高性能的消息队列系统在淘客返利系统中的应用大家好,我是微赚淘客系统3.0的小编,是个冬天不穿秋裤,天冷也要风度的程序猿!消息队列系统是一种重要的组件,用于实现系统之间的异步通信和解耦。在淘客返利系统中,通过使用高性能的Java消息队列系统,可以提高系统的稳定性......
  • Java开发手册中-要求日志输出时字符串变量之间的拼接使用占位符与使用字符串拼接性能
    场景Java中使用JMH(JavaMicrobenchmarkHarness微基准测试框架)进行性能测试和优化:https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/131723751参考以上性能测试工具的使用。Java开发手册中有这样一条:【强制】在日志输出时,字符串变量之间的拼接使用占位符的方式......
  • java八股复习指南-计网篇
    网络分层模型osi七层模型tcp-ip四层模型应用层传输层网络层网络接口层与osi七层模型对应为:应用层主要提供两个终端设备上应用之间的消息交换的服务。它定义了消息交换的格式。常见协议有:结合常见的协议,可以这样理解应用层:应用层就是专门为特定的应用之间的通信提......
  • 基于SpringBoot的宠物领养系统-07863(免费领源码+开发文档)可做计算机毕业设计JAVA、PHP
    摘 要21世纪的今天,随着社会的不断发展与进步,人们对于信息科学化的认识,已由低层次向高层次发展,由原来的感性认识向理性认识提高,管理工作的重要性已逐渐被人们所认识,科学化的管理,使信息存储达到准确、快速、完善,并能提高工作管理效率,促进其发展。论文主要是对宠物领养系统......
  • ubuntu 20 pyenv安装python环境
    安装pyenvgitclonehttps://github.com/pyenv/pyenv.git~/.pyenv或者自动安装程序curlhttps://pyenv.run|bash依赖库sudoapt-getupdatesudoapt-getupgradesudoapt-getinstallgccmakezlib1g-devdist-upgradesudoapt-getinstalllibbz2-devbuild-essenti......